Home
last modified time | relevance | path

Searched full:sun6i (Results 1 – 25 of 144) sorted by relevance

123456

/Linux-v5.15/Documentation/devicetree/bindings/mfd/
Dallwinner,sun6i-a31-prcm.yaml4 $id: http://devicetree.org/schemas/mfd/allwinner,sun6i-a31-prcm.yaml#
17 const: allwinner,sun6i-a31-prcm
30 - allwinner,sun6i-a31-apb0-clk
31 - allwinner,sun6i-a31-apb0-gates-clk
32 - allwinner,sun6i-a31-ar100-clk
33 - allwinner,sun6i-a31-clock-reset
41 const: allwinner,sun6i-a31-apb0-clk
71 const: allwinner,sun6i-a31-apb0-gates-clk
106 const: allwinner,sun6i-a31-ar100-clk
139 const: allwinner,sun6i-a31-clock-reset
[all …]
/Linux-v5.15/drivers/mfd/
Dsun6i-prcm.c48 .name = "sun6i-a31-ar100-clk",
49 .of_compatible = "allwinner,sun6i-a31-ar100-clk",
54 .name = "sun6i-a31-apb0-clk",
55 .of_compatible = "allwinner,sun6i-a31-apb0-clk",
60 .name = "sun6i-a31-apb0-gates-clk",
61 .of_compatible = "allwinner,sun6i-a31-apb0-gates-clk",
66 .name = "sun6i-a31-ir-clk",
72 .name = "sun6i-a31-apb0-clock-reset",
73 .of_compatible = "allwinner,sun6i-a31-clock-reset",
87 .name = "sun6i-a31-apb0-gates-clk",
[all …]
/Linux-v5.15/Documentation/devicetree/bindings/reset/
Dallwinner,sun6i-a31-clock-reset.yaml4 $id: http://devicetree.org/schemas/reset/allwinner,sun6i-a31-clock-reset.yaml#
20 - allwinner,sun6i-a31-ahb1-reset
21 - allwinner,sun6i-a31-clock-reset
40 - allwinner,sun6i-a31-ahb1-reset
41 - allwinner,sun6i-a31-clock-reset
57 compatible = "allwinner,sun6i-a31-ahb1-reset";
64 compatible = "allwinner,sun6i-a31-clock-reset";
/Linux-v5.15/arch/arm/boot/dts/
Dsun6i-a31.dtsi48 #include <dt-bindings/clock/sun6i-a31-ccu.h>
49 #include <dt-bindings/reset/sun6i-a31-ccu.h>
98 enable-method = "allwinner,sun6i-a31";
264 compatible = "allwinner,sun6i-a31-display-engine";
276 compatible = "allwinner,sun6i-a31-dma";
285 compatible = "allwinner,sun6i-a31-tcon";
339 compatible = "allwinner,sun6i-a31-tcon";
472 compatible = "allwinner,sun6i-a31-hdmi";
512 compatible = "allwinner,sun6i-a31-musb";
526 compatible = "allwinner,sun6i-a31-usb-phy";
[all …]
Dsun6i-a31s.dtsi49 #include "sun6i-a31.dtsi"
52 compatible = "allwinner,sun6i-a31s-display-engine";
56 compatible = "allwinner,sun6i-a31s-pinctrl";
60 compatible = "allwinner,sun6i-a31s-tcon";
/Linux-v5.15/Documentation/devicetree/bindings/hwlock/
Dallwinner,sun6i-a31-hwspinlock.yaml4 $id: http://devicetree.org/schemas/hwlock/allwinner,sun6i-a31-hwspinlock.yaml#
7 title: SUN6I hardware spinlock driver for Allwinner sun6i compatible SoCs
18 const: allwinner,sun6i-a31-hwspinlock
43 compatible = "allwinner,sun6i-a31-hwspinlock";
/Linux-v5.15/Documentation/devicetree/bindings/display/
Dallwinner,sun6i-a31-drc.yaml4 $id: http://devicetree.org/schemas/display/allwinner,sun6i-a31-drc.yaml#
21 - allwinner,sun6i-a31-drc
22 - allwinner,sun6i-a31s-drc
81 #include <dt-bindings/clock/sun6i-a31-ccu.h>
82 #include <dt-bindings/reset/sun6i-a31-ccu.h>
85 compatible = "allwinner,sun6i-a31-drc";
Dallwinner,sun4i-a10-tcon.yaml25 - const: allwinner,sun6i-a31-tcon
26 - const: allwinner,sun6i-a31s-tcon
192 - allwinner,sun6i-a31-tcon
193 - allwinner,sun6i-a31s-tcon
270 - allwinner,sun6i-a31-tcon
271 - allwinner,sun6i-a31s-tcon
290 - allwinner,sun6i-a31-tcon
291 - allwinner,sun6i-a31s-tcon
348 - allwinner,sun6i-a31-tcon
349 - allwinner,sun6i-a31s-tcon
[all …]
Dallwinner,sun6i-a31-mipi-dsi.yaml4 $id: http://devicetree.org/schemas/display/allwinner,sun6i-a31-mipi-dsi.yaml#
16 - allwinner,sun6i-a31-mipi-dsi
71 const: allwinner,sun6i-a31-mipi-dsi
97 compatible = "allwinner,sun6i-a31-mipi-dsi";
Dallwinner,sun4i-a10-display-engine.yaml55 - allwinner,sun6i-a31-display-engine
56 - allwinner,sun6i-a31s-display-engine
88 - allwinner,sun6i-a31-display-engine
89 - allwinner,sun6i-a31s-display-engine
/Linux-v5.15/Documentation/devicetree/bindings/mailbox/
Dallwinner,sun6i-a31-msgbox.yaml4 $id: http://devicetree.org/schemas/mailbox/allwinner,sun6i-a31-msgbox.yaml#
13 The hardware message box on sun6i, sun8i, sun9i, and sun50i SoCs is a
33 - const: allwinner,sun6i-a31-msgbox
34 - const: allwinner,sun6i-a31-msgbox
72 "allwinner,sun6i-a31-msgbox";
/Linux-v5.15/Documentation/devicetree/bindings/phy/
Dallwinner,sun6i-a31-mipi-dphy.yaml4 $id: http://devicetree.org/schemas/phy/allwinner,sun6i-a31-mipi-dphy.yaml#
19 - const: allwinner,sun6i-a31-mipi-dphy
22 - const: allwinner,sun6i-a31-mipi-dphy
53 compatible = "allwinner,sun6i-a31-mipi-dphy";
Dallwinner,sun6i-a31-usb-phy.yaml4 $id: http://devicetree.org/schemas/phy/allwinner,sun6i-a31-usb-phy.yaml#
18 const: allwinner,sun6i-a31-usb-phy
91 #include <dt-bindings/clock/sun6i-a31-ccu.h>
92 #include <dt-bindings/reset/sun6i-a31-ccu.h>
96 compatible = "allwinner,sun6i-a31-usb-phy";
/Linux-v5.15/Documentation/devicetree/bindings/interrupt-controller/
Dallwinner,sun6i-a31-r-intc.yaml4 $id: http://devicetree.org/schemas/interrupt-controller/allwinner,sun6i-a31-r-intc.yaml#
26 - const: allwinner,sun6i-a31-r-intc
32 - const: allwinner,sun6i-a31-r-intc
60 "allwinner,sun6i-a31-r-intc";
/Linux-v5.15/drivers/clk/sunxi/
DMakefile29 obj-$(CONFIG_CLK_SUNXI_PRCM_SUN6I) += clk-sun6i-apb0.o
30 obj-$(CONFIG_CLK_SUNXI_PRCM_SUN6I) += clk-sun6i-apb0-gates.o
31 obj-$(CONFIG_CLK_SUNXI_PRCM_SUN6I) += clk-sun6i-ar100.o
34 obj-$(CONFIG_CLK_SUNXI_PRCM_SUN8I) += clk-sun6i-apb0-gates.o
/Linux-v5.15/drivers/soc/sunxi/
Dsunxi_mbus.c21 "allwinner,sun6i-a31-display-engine",
22 "allwinner,sun6i-a31s-display-engine",
38 "allwinner,sun6i-a31-csi",
39 "allwinner,sun6i-a31-display-backend",
103 "allwinner,sun6i-a31",
/Linux-v5.15/Documentation/devicetree/bindings/rtc/
Dallwinner,sun6i-a31-rtc.yaml4 $id: http://devicetree.org/schemas/rtc/allwinner,sun6i-a31-rtc.yaml#
19 - const: allwinner,sun6i-a31-rtc
58 const: allwinner,sun6i-a31-rtc
137 compatible = "allwinner,sun6i-a31-rtc";
/Linux-v5.15/Documentation/devicetree/bindings/i2c/
Dmarvell,mv64xxx-i2c.yaml19 - const: allwinner,sun6i-a31-i2c
28 - const: allwinner,sun6i-a31-i2c
74 - allwinner,sun6i-a31-i2c
84 const: allwinner,sun6i-a31-i2c
Dallwinner,sun6i-a31-p2wi.yaml4 $id: http://devicetree.org/schemas/i2c/allwinner,sun6i-a31-p2wi.yaml#
18 const: allwinner,sun6i-a31-p2wi
48 compatible = "allwinner,sun6i-a31-p2wi";
/Linux-v5.15/Documentation/devicetree/bindings/sound/
Dallwinner,sun4i-a10-codec.yaml20 - allwinner,sun6i-a31-codec
109 - allwinner,sun6i-a31-codec
118 const: allwinner,sun6i-a31-codec
135 - allwinner,sun6i-a31-codec
249 compatible = "allwinner,sun6i-a31-codec";
/Linux-v5.15/Documentation/devicetree/bindings/clock/
Dallwinner,sun6i-a31-pll6-clk.yaml4 $id: http://devicetree.org/schemas/clock/allwinner,sun6i-a31-pll6-clk.yaml#
23 const: allwinner,sun6i-a31-pll6-clk
47 compatible = "allwinner,sun6i-a31-pll6-clk";
/Linux-v5.15/drivers/hwspinlock/
DKconfig48 tristate "SUN6I Hardware Spinlock device"
51 Say y here to support the SUN6I Hardware Spinlock device which can be
52 found in most of the sun6i compatible Allwinner SoCs.
/Linux-v5.15/Documentation/devicetree/bindings/dma/
Dallwinner,sun6i-a31-dma.yaml4 $id: http://devicetree.org/schemas/dma/allwinner,sun6i-a31-dma.yaml#
23 - allwinner,sun6i-a31-dma
54 compatible = "allwinner,sun6i-a31-dma";
/Linux-v5.15/Documentation/devicetree/bindings/pinctrl/
Dallwinner,sun4i-a10-pinctrl.yaml33 - allwinner,sun6i-a31-pinctrl
34 - allwinner,sun6i-a31-r-pinctrl
35 - allwinner,sun6i-a31s-pinctrl
189 - allwinner,sun6i-a31-pinctrl
190 - allwinner,sun6i-a31s-pinctrl
219 - allwinner,sun6i-a31-r-pinctrl
/Linux-v5.15/Documentation/devicetree/bindings/arm/
Dsunxi.yaml32 - const: allwinner,sun6i-a31
87 - const: allwinner,sun6i-a31s
162 - const: allwinner,sun6i-a31s
167 - const: allwinner,sun6i-a31s
347 - const: allwinner,sun6i-a31s
460 - const: allwinner,sun6i-a31
465 - const: allwinner,sun6i-a31
475 - const: allwinner,sun6i-a31
485 - const: allwinner,sun6i-a31
520 - const: allwinner,sun6i-a31s
[all …]

123456